Просмотр исходного кода

add/update copyright, remove warnings

richarddobson 2 лет назад
Родитель
Сommit
54f432326a
3 измененных файлов с 8 добавлено и 8 удалено
  1. 2 2
      dev/science/multiosc.c
  2. 2 2
      dev/science/peakiso.c
  3. 4 4
      dev/science/synthesis.c

+ 2 - 2
dev/science/multiosc.c

@@ -1237,7 +1237,7 @@ int multiosc(dataptr dz)
 {
     int exit_status, oscilcnt = 0;
     double time, val, srate, onehzincr /* , spliceincr = 0.0 , upspliceval = 0.0, dnspliceval = 1.0 */;
-    int infade = 0 /*, outfade = 0 */;
+//    int infade = 0, outfade = 0;
     float *obuf = dz->sampbuf[0];
     int obufpos = 0, outsamps = 0;
     double tabpos = 0.0, tabpos2 = 0.0, tabpos3 = 0.0, tabpos4 = 0.0;
@@ -1247,7 +1247,7 @@ int multiosc(dataptr dz)
     case(DOUBLE_OSC):    oscilcnt = 2;  break;
     }
     srate = (double)dz->iparam[MOSC_SRATE];
-    infade = (int)floor(dz->param[MOSC_SPLEN] * MS_TO_SECS * srate);
+//    infade = (int)floor(dz->param[MOSC_SPLEN] * MS_TO_SECS * srate);
 //    outfade = dz->iparam[MOSC_DUR] - infade;
 //    spliceincr = 1.0/infade;
 //    upspliceval = 0.0;

+ 2 - 2
dev/science/peakiso.c

@@ -1,5 +1,5 @@
 /*
- * Copyright (c) 1983-2013 Trevor Wishart and Composers Desktop Project Ltd
+ * Copyright (c) 1983-2023 Trevor Wishart and Composers Desktop Project Ltd
  * http://www.trevorwishart.co.uk
  * http://www.composersdesktop.com
  *
@@ -224,7 +224,7 @@ int peakiso(double *parray,int itemcnt,double *outarray,double minnotch)
     int ampat, trofampat, pkampbelowat, pkampaboveat, nexttrofat, writeat, j;
     double amp, lastamp, ampstep, lastampstep, belowstep, abovestep, notchdepth;
     double *pkbefore, *pkafter, *notch;
-    int trofcnt, badnotches, jj, kk, notchwidth, prepeak, postpeak, pksttej, pkendej;
+    int trofcnt, badnotches, jj, kk, notchwidth, prepeak, postpeak, pksttej, pkendej=0;
     int ampsttej, ampendej;
     double sttval, endval;
     int *pkbeforeat, *notchat, *orig_notchat;

+ 4 - 4
dev/science/synthesis.c

@@ -1,5 +1,5 @@
 /*
- * Copyright (c) 1983-2013 Trevor Wishart and Composers Desktop Project Ltd
+ * Copyright (c) 1983-2023 Trevor Wishart and Composers Desktop Project Ltd
  * http://www.trevorwishart.co.uk
  * http://www.composersdesktop.com
  *
@@ -141,7 +141,7 @@ int main(int argc,char *argv[])
     dataptr dz = NULL;
     char **cmdline, sfnam[400];
     int  cmdlinecnt;
-    aplptr ap;
+//    aplptr ap;
     int is_launched = FALSE;
     int *perm, *permon, *permoff, *superperm;
     int maxsteps = 0;
@@ -215,7 +215,7 @@ int main(int argc,char *argv[])
             return(exit_status);         
         }
     }
-    ap = dz->application;
+//    ap = dz->application;
     dz->infile->channels = 1;
     // parse_infile_and_hone_type() = 
     // setup_param_ranges_and_defaults() =
@@ -3047,7 +3047,7 @@ int create_synthesizer_sndbufs(dataptr dz)
         sprintf(errstr,"INSUFFICIENT MEMORY establishing sample buffer pointers.\n");
         return(MEMORY_ERROR);
     }
-    bigbufsize = (int)Malloc(-1);
+    bigbufsize = (int)(size_t) Malloc(-1);
     bigbufsize /= dz->bufcnt;
     if(bigbufsize <=0)
         bigbufsize  = framesize * sizeof(float);